Highest Education Level

Medical Technologists in Fostoria, OH offer the following education background
Bachelor's Degree
29.7%
Vocational Degree or Certification
23.7%
High School or GED
18.4%
Associate's Degree
17.4%
Master's Degree
6.7%
Doctorate Degree
1.9%
Some College
1.8%
Some High School
0.4%
